Sprinkles of rain came and went before practice A, in what turned out to be 3 eventful practice sessions on day one for the V8 Supercars.
Going out on wets to road the tyres, they were soon taken off on the first stop and dries on to get the session going.
'We are running a similar set up to last year as it worked well for us, and will hopefully do the same this year'.
Consistent times to keep The Bottle - O Commodore in the top 15 were pumped out, but with a flat spot on the right front late in the session #55 sat out the last few minutes, as by the time the tyres were changed and up to temperature the session would have been over.
Practice B had T.D set a time of 1.11.3631 in a session that was red flagged twice. A slight vibration formed which led to a steering rack change which in turn ate up the first 30 minutes of practice C, leaving 20 minutes remaining.
Back out on the track The Bottle - O Commodore steped up a notch and steadily kept improving its times to set a 1.10.5123 with 1 minute remaining to finish the session in tenth.
'It was a big task to do a steering rack change in such a short period, but the boys did a fantastic job. We didn't even use green tyres today, so I think better things are to come. I am very happy with the car and feel confident we can produce good results tomorrow'.
Day two begins with qualifying at 11am, before race one of the round at 4.05pm.
